Teaching tips for Management of Natural Resources

  • 1Organize a field trip to a local water body to observe conservation efforts
  • 2Conduct a debate on the impact of deforestation in local areas
  • 3Invite local environmental activists to share their experiences
  • 4Use case studies of successful renewable energy projects in India for group discussions

Board exam relevance

Questions may include MCQs on key terms, short answer questions on conservation methods, and 5-mark long answer questions discussing specific case studies like the Chipko Movement.
